With point in "driverMain":
(Integer)driverMain.invoke ...
C-c C-v C-y returns
Wrong type argument: number-or-marker-p, nil
Backtrace attached.
C-c C-v C-y works correctly with a space after the cast:
(Integer) driverMain.invoke ...
It would be more convenient if jde-parse.el could handle both styles.
